Arizona 5, Milwaukee 2

–Zach Davies gave up four runs in four innings and the Brewers offense struggled to make any noise in a loss in the series finale against the Diamondbacks at Miller Park on Sunday afternoon. Manny Pina hit a solo home run in the loss – that saw the Brewers strand 10 men on base, including two on with two out in the ninth with Christian Yelich at the plate representing the tying run. Yelich grounded out to second after an eight-pitch at bat to end the game. Baseball News: 

The Brewers have designated pitcher Jhoulys Chacin for assignment, ending a disappointing season for someone who was expected to be one of their top pitchers in 2019. One season after going 15-8 with a 3.50 ERA, Chacin dropped to 3-10 with a 5.79 ERA this season – winning his opening day start against St. Louis, but only winning twice more since that day – his last victory coming April 30th. Chacin was placed on the injured list a week ago and was expected to return sometime next month. Utility player Corey Spangenberg was recalled from Triple-A San Antonio to take Chacin’s spot on the roster

The Brewers placed reliever Jeremy Jeffress on the 10-day injured list on Sunday with a strained left hip. Jeffress had been struggling since the All-Star Break, owning a 7.56 ERA in 16.2 innings. To take his spot on the roster, the Brewers recalled relieve Ray Black from San Antonio.

NFL News: 

The Packers have released safety Josh Jones. Jones was a second round pick in the 2017 NFL Draft, and had sat out much of the offseason program after requesting a trade. He started five of the Packers last six games in 2018, finishing sixth in tackles with 60. Jones hadn’t practiced since August 11th because of an illness, and had fallen behind fellow safeties Adrian Amos, Darnell Savage and Raven Greene on the depth chart. 

College Football: 

The Badgers have named junior Jack Coan as their starting quarterback for Friday’s season opener at South Florida. The New York native was competing against redshirt freshman Chase Wolf and true freshman Graham Mertz for the starting job in camp. Both Wolf and Mertz are listed as backups to Coan.
